如何利用软件开发项目管理文件提升团队效率?5个实用技巧分享

软件开发项目管理文件的重要性

软件开发项目管理文件是确保项目成功的关键要素之一。它不仅能够提高团队协作效率,还能够有效控制项目风险,确保项目按时、按质完成。在当今快速发展的软件行业中,掌握如何利用这些文件来提升团队效率显得尤为重要。本文将分享5个实用技巧,帮助您更好地管理软件开发项目,提高团队整体效能。

 

明确项目目标和范围

在开始任何软件开发项目之前,制定一份详细的项目章程至关重要。这份文件应该清晰地定义项目的目标、范围、时间表和资源分配。通过明确这些关键信息,团队成员可以更好地理解自己的职责和项目的整体方向。

为了确保项目章程的有效性,可以采用以下步骤:

1. 召开项目启动会议,邀请所有相关利益相关者参与。

2. 讨论并记录项目的具体目标和预期成果。

3. 明确项目的边界,包括哪些内容属于项目范围,哪些不属于。

4. 制定初步的时间表和里程碑。

5. 确定项目所需的人力和物力资源。

通过使用ONES研发管理平台,您可以轻松创建和管理项目章程,确保所有团队成员都能随时访问最新的项目信息。

 

创建详细的工作分解结构(WBS)

工作分解结构(WBS)是一个强大的项目管理工具,它将项目分解为可管理的任务和子任务。通过创建详细的WBS,团队可以更好地理解项目的复杂性,并确保没有遗漏重要的工作项。

以下是创建有效WBS的步骤:

1. 从项目的最终交付成果开始,逐步向下分解。

2. 确保每个工作包都是可管理、可估算的。

3. 使用统一的编号系统,便于跟踪和引用。

4. 邀请团队成员参与WBS的创建过程,以确保全面性。

5. 定期审查和更新WBS,以反映项目的变化。

ONES研发管理平台提供了直观的WBS创建和管理工具,能够帮助团队更有效地组织和跟踪项目任务。

 

制定全面的风险管理计划

在软件开发过程中,风险管理是不可或缺的一环。一个全面的风险管理计划可以帮助团队识别潜在的问题,并制定相应的应对策略,从而减少项目失败的可能性。

以下是制定风险管理计划的关键步骤:

1. 识别潜在风险:组织头脑风暴会议,列出可能影响项目的所有风险。

2. 评估风险:对每个风险的发生概率和潜在影响进行评估。

3. 制定应对策略:为每个重大风险制定预防和应对措施。

4. 分配责任:明确每个风险的负责人。

5. 监控和更新:定期审查风险状态,并根据需要更新计划。

使用ONES研发管理平台的风险管理模块,可以更系统地跟踪和管理项目风险,确保团队始终保持警惕。

 

建立有效的沟通计划

良好的沟通是软件开发项目成功的关键。一个详细的沟通计划可以确保所有利益相关者都能及时获得所需的信息,从而提高决策效率和团队协作。

制定沟通计划时,应考虑以下方面:

1. 确定关键利益相关者及其信息需求。

2. 选择适当的沟通渠道(如电子邮件、会议、项目管理工具等)。

3. 制定定期报告和会议计划。

4. 明确每种沟通的频率、格式和责任人。

5. 建立反馈机制,确保沟通的有效性。

ONES研发管理平台提供了集成的沟通工具,可以帮助团队更轻松地实施沟通计划,保持信息的透明度和及时性。

 

实施变更管理流程

在软件开发过程中,变更是不可避免的。一个有效的变更管理流程可以帮助团队更好地控制项目范围,避免”范围蔓延”,同时确保必要的变更能够得到适当的评估和实施。

以下是建立变更管理流程的步骤:

1. 创建变更请求表单,包括变更描述、原因、影响分析等字段。

2. 制定变更评估标准,考虑时间、成本、质量等因素。

3. 建立变更审批流程,明确审批人员和权限。

4. 记录所有变更决策,包括批准、拒绝或推迟的原因。

5. 定期审查变更日志,评估变更对项目的累积影响。

ONES研发管理平台的变更管理功能可以帮助团队更有效地追踪和管理项目变更,确保项目始终保持在正确的轨道上。

软件开发项目管理文件

总结而言,软件开发项目管理文件是提升团队效率的重要工具。通过明确项目目标和范围、创建详细的工作分解结构、制定全面的风险管理计划、建立有效的沟通计划以及实施变更管理流程,团队可以显著提高项目成功的机会。这些文件不仅能够帮助团队更好地组织和管理工作,还能促进团队成员之间的协作和沟通。在实施这些策略时,选择合适的项目管理工具如ONES研发管理平台可以大大简化流程,提高效率。最后,我们鼓励所有软件开发团队重视项目管理文件的作用,将其作为提升团队效能的有力武器,为项目的成功保驾护航。